Thu 11 Nov 2007O'Toole warns of dangers to unarmed
gardaíCéifin Conference:Chief inspector of the
Garda Síochána Inspectorate Kathleen O'Toole said
yesterday she was worried about the safety of unarmed gardaí
because of increasing gang-related violence.However, she hoped she would never have to recommend arming all
gardaí. She said she had "a huge respect" for the fact that
gardaí were routinely unarmed.
